I have recently begone an obsession with using twine instead of ribbon on my pages. Especially boy pages. I just love the roughened look of it.


This is one of my new favorite pages. It just perfectly captures my niece Janieka. Its rough and ragged around the edges, full of fun and life, and yet still adds a touch of blossoming elegance and grace.

This page was a challenge. I love pages that already have all the decorations and designs to them, but I rarely end up using them. I don't know what to do with it. I don't want to cover up all the fun designs, but I also don't want it to be too plain and unembellished. I stuck a happy medium with this one. I stitched the existing design to add a bit of dimension, then just glittered the flowers. Just those little touches make it really pop. I'm very happy with how it turned out.

There's not much to say about this one. Is simplistic beauty. I did fray the bottom edge of the ribbon to add a bit of edge to it. But from the colors to the papers, I love it.

I wanted something bright and wild to capture the 150mps that is my nephew Alex. I think I accomplished that rather well. Its simple yet so fun.  And again, I am sure I am driving Krista crazy with my use of mixed patterns. I see no reason circles, squares, and stripes can't coexist peacefully.
